As a Security Professional - Armed Government Site Patrol in Reno, NV , you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Government and more .

As an Armed Patrol Officer in a government location, you will monitor and patrol assigned areas, helping to deter security-related incidents while maintaining a visible presence. Your role involves conducting routine patrols, responding to incidents, and providing outstanding customer service and communication. This armed post offers the opportunity to make a meaningful impact in a dynamic environment, supported by a team that values agility, reliability, and innovation. Join a company that puts people first, works together through teamwork, and always acts with integrity.

Position Type: Full Time

Pay Rate: $22.00 / Hour

Responsibilities:

  • Provide customer service to clients by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ies and when appropriate, emergency response activities.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ner.
  • Conduct regular and random armed patrols around the government location and perimeter to help to deter unauthorized activity.
  • Monitor for suspicious behavior and report any security-related concerns to the appropriate authorities.
  • Maintain a visible presence to help to deter potential threats and provide reassurance to employees and visitors.
  • Assist with access control by verifying identification and/or credentials as required by site policies.
  • Document incidents and daily activities in accordance with site requirements.

Minimum Requirements:

  • Must have an armed designation and be at least 21 years of age for armed roles.
  • Graduate of a law enforcement or military police training program or equivalent experience is required.
  • CPR and First Aid certification is preferred.
  • Nevada Security Professional Guard Card is preferred.
  • Be at least 18 years of age for unarmed roles; 21 years of age for armed roles.
  • Possess a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a background investigation in accordance with all federal, state, and local laws.
  • Allied Universal will consider qualified applications with criminal histories in a manner consistent with applicable laws.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a drug screen to the extent permitted by law.
  • Licensing requirements are subject to state and/or local laws and regulations and may be required prior to employment.
  • A valid driver's license will be required for driving positions only.
